Development of plasma cutter machine as a teaching support tool in engineering careers

The use of automated equipment such as the plasma cutter reduces manufacturing times, in addition to being more accurate in the cutting of a wide range of metals, the use of this type of device optimizes manufacturing processes in the manufacture of equipment for processing raw materials from the agricultural sector, as well as electromechanical equipment and implements used in the agro-industrial sector. From the academic point of view, the use of this type of machine familiarizes future professionals with new generation equipment and reduces the duration of laboratory practices, which decreases the stress and anxiety conditions of the engineering students, improving their academic performance. Therefore, the objective of this research was to design a prototype plasma cutter, which was used for the practical activities of the electromechanical engineering student, for the evaluation of the efficiency of the prototype, the duration of the academic activities was quantified, as well as the degree of satisfaction of the students in the elaboration of the academic activities. The results found reveal that the practice time was considerably reduced compared to practices carried out under conventional educational approaches, in addition to the fact that the level of stress and anxiety among the students who used the plasma cutter in their practical activities was lower, which positively influenced their academic performance.
